Section 3 - Hazards Identification

Emergency Overview
Appearance: Clear yellow-green liquid.
Caution! Corrosive. Causes severe eye and skin burns. Causes severe digestive and
respiratory tract burns.
Target Organs: None.

Potential Health Effects
Eye:
Vapors are irritating to the eye, liquid contact may result in clouding of the cornea, erosion, up to
total corneal opacification and loss of the eye.
Skin:
May cause severe burns and ulceration. Skin may turn brown-yellow. Deep burns are slow to heal
and scarring may occur.




-1 -
Material Safety Data Sheet
Ammonium Molybdovanadate Solutions
Ingestion:
Causes severe digestive tract burns with abdominal pain, vomiting, and possible death. May cause
corrosion and permanent tissue destruction of the esophagus and digestive tract.
Inhalation:
May cause irritation of the respiratory tract with burning pain in the nose and throat, coughing,
wheezing, shortness of breath and pulmonary edema. May cause severe irritation of the respiratory
tract with sore throat, coughing, shortness of breath and delayed lung edema. Palpitation,
inflammation, edema of the larynx and bronchi, chemical pneumonitis and pulmonary edema may
result from inhalation exposure.
Chronic:
Chronic exposure may result in dental erosion, jaw necrosis, respiratory disease, dermatitis,
conjunctivitis, corneal scarring and fever.

Section 4 - First Aid Measures

Eyes:
Immediately flush eyes with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es, occasionally lifting the upper
and lower lids until chemical is gone. Get medical aid at once. SPEEDY ACTION IS CRITICAL!
Skin:
Get medical aid at once. Immediately flush skin with plenty of soap and water for at least 15
minutes while removing contaminated clothing and shoes. SPEEDY ACTION IS CRITICAL!
Ingestion:
Do NOT induce vomiting. Give conscious victim 2-4 cupfuls of milk or water. Never give anything
by mouth to an unconscious person. Get medical aid at once.
Inhalation:
Get medical aid at once. Move victim to fresh air immediately. Give artificial respiration if
necessary. If breathing is difficult, give oxygen.
Notes to Physician:
Treat symptomatically and supportively.

Section 6 - Accidental Release Measures
General Information:
Use proper personal protective equipment as indicated in Section 8.
Spills/Leaks:
Absorb spills with absorbent (vermiculite, sand, fuller's earth) and place in plastic bags for later
disposal. Large spills may be neutralized with dilute alkaline solutions of soda ash, or lime. Clean
up spills immediately, observing precautions in the Protective Equipment section.

Section 7 - Handling and Storage

Handling:
Wash thoroughly after handling. Wash hands before eating. Use only in a well ventilated area. Do
not get in eyes, on skin, or on clothing. Do not ingest or inhale. Do not allow contact with water.
Use caution when opening.
Storage:
Store in a cool, dry area. Store in a tightly closed container.

LD50/LC50:
CAS# 7732-18-5:
Oral, rat: LD50 = >90 mL/kg.
CAS# 7647-01-0:
Inhalation, mouse: LC50 =1108 ppm/1H
Inhalation, rat: LC50 =3124 ppm/1H
Oral, rabbit: LD50 = 900 mg/kg.
CAS# 12054-85-2: No information found.
CAS# 7803-55-6:
Oral, rat: LD50 = 160 mg/kg.
Intraperitoneal, rat: LD50 = 18 mg/kg.
Subcutaneous, rat: LD50 = 23 mg/kg.
